发明名称 TOUGHNESS INCREASING METHOD FOR STEEL
摘要 PURPOSE:To manufacture steel with high toughness at low cost by treating steel, which contains C, Si, Mn, and Al at a specific ratio, by reheating, rolling, forcible cooling, and quenching under specific conditions. CONSTITUTION:Steel which consists of 0.01-0.20% C, <=1% Si, 0.5-3% Mn, 0.01-0.1% Al, the balance Fe with inevitable impurities is reheated above a point Ac3. Then, rolling is carried out at <=900 deg.C under >=30% cumulative pressure within the range of an Ar3 transformation point. Successively, forcible cooling is performed from temperature above the Ar3 point down to <=300 deg.C at a 2-100 deg.C/sec cooling speed. Further, a quenching treatment is performed at some temperature between 500 deg.C and an Ac1 transformation point. For higher strength and toughness, <=10% Ni, 0.01-0.1% Nb, <=1.5% Cr, 0.01-0.1% V, <=1.0% Mo, 0.005-0.03% Ti, <=1.0% Cu, Ca, 0.5-2.0 XS REM, and <=0.003% S are added.
